General-duty citation text
Section 5(a)(1) of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970: The employer did not furnish employmnent and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to: Location: Establishment, Recieving Area a) Employer did not train employees in the safe operation of the compactors, exposing employees to the hazard of being crushed on or about 07/14/10. AMONG OTHER METHODS, ONE FEASIBLE AND ACCEPTABLE METHOD TO CORRECT THIS HAZARD IS TO FOLLOW THE ANSI Z245.2-2004, WHICH STATES THAT THE OWNER/EMPLOYER SHALL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R "PROVIDING TO EMPLOYEES INSTRUCTION AND TRAINING IN SAFE WORK METHODS BEFORE ASSIGNING THEM TO OPERATE, CLEAN, SERVICE, MAINTAIN, MODIFY, OR REPAIR THE STATIONARY COMPACTOR. SUCH INSTRUCTION AND TRAINING SHALL INCLUDE PROCEDURES PROVIDED BY THE MANUFACTURER. THE EMPLOYER WILL MAINTAIN RECORDS AS TO THE NAMES OF EMPLOYEES AND THE DATES OF TRAINING". NOTE: Because abatement of this violation is already documented in the inspection case file, the employer need not submit certification or documentation of abatement for this violation as normally required by 29 CFR 1903.19.
